Output 58b1a5bf34d3bba88a11289c610783ef7028de98143e88fc5f1ecacdb593eb5a:0

value
20589962999
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f41ae45ae4c082898e84f330c9f16dfa11fc59b5 OP_EQUALVERIFY OP_CHECKSIG
address
1PFi6JByvBedWGM6LUkhKmPG2Ukx4GcsDS
transaction
58b1a5bf34d3bba88a11289c610783ef7028de98143e88fc5f1ecacdb593eb5a
spent
true